No. 2 Cal Men's Water Polo Defeats No. 7 UC Santa Barbara, 19-6

Oct. 29, 2006

BERKELEY, CALIF. - Powered by four goals from junior Jeff Tyrrell, and three goals apiece from senior John Mann and junior Michael Sharf, the No. 2-ranked California men's water polo team (21-3, 4-1 MPSF) defeated No. 7-ranked UC Santa Barbara (16-11, 1-3 MPSF) Sunday at Spieker Aquatics Complex. The Golden Bears, which had 10 different players score during the afternoon, were also led by seniors Andrija Vasiljevic and Marty Matthies, who notched two goals apiece. Junior goalie Mark Sheredy finished with six saves.

After Sharf scored Cal's first goal on a five-meter penalty shot with 3:50 left in the first period, the Gauchos' Stefan Partelow was able the contest on a counterattack goal with 2:10 remaining in the first. But, that was as close as UC Santa Barbara would get as the Bears went on a 5-0 run at the end of the first quarter and the beginning of the second period behind goals from senior Brian Bacharach, Tyrrell, Sharf, Matthies and Mann.

Cal proceeded to go on a 6-0 run, a 5-0 run, and scored seven goals during the fourth period, on the way to the 19-6 win. Other scorers for the Gauchos included two goals by Ross Sinclair and goals by Alex Young, Miles Price and Tamas Donauer. Goalie Rick Wright tallied seven saves.

Sharf led the Bears with three steals, juniors Mike Hayes and Zac Monsees paced Cal with three assists apiece, and Mann and senior center Brian Kinsel each had three ejections earned. Junior Adam Haley led the Bears with two field blocks. Cal was 19-for-29 on shots on goal, and was 4-for-5 on 6-on-5 advantages. The Bears held UCSB to 1-for-5 on man-up advantages.

Cal will next host No. 3-ranked UCLA at 1:30 p.m., Saturday, Nov. 4 at Spieker Aquatics Complex.
